Berlinerkranser Serves 40. This is a traditional Norwegian Christmas cookie that is on the annual baking list for my grandma and mom, and now me. The dipping can be a bit tricky but it's fun too. For dough: 2 raw egg yolks 2 hard boiled egg yolks 1/2 c sugar 1 c butter 2 c flour For dipping: 1 c Perl Sugar 2 whisked egg whites Work well together the raw and hard boiled egg yolks. Add the sugar. Work in the butter alternating with the flour to form a smooth dough. Roll into long roll with the hands (about 1/2" thick). Cut this in to about 3" pieces. Then form each piece into a little roll. Make a circle of each roll, crossing the ends. Dip each into slightly beaten egg whites, then into coarse (perl) sugar. Bake a delicate brown 10 to 15 minutes at 300 F. Keywords: Intermediate, Dessert, Cookie, Christmas ( RG1535 )
